Skip to main content

A responsive theme based on sunburst for Plone 4

Project description

Introduction
============

This Responsive Theme product will give your Plone a responsive theme on install. But you can also include collective.responsivetheme to the custom theme you are making. Here is how you do it.

1. Make sure when buildout is run, it will get collective.responsivetheme. We will pretend you theme is named "plonetheme.yourcustomtheme". Within the first folder of plonetheme.yourcustomtheme is a file named setup.py. In the install_requires portion add this: ::

install_requires=[
'setuptools',
'collective.responsivetheme',
# -*- Extra requirements: -*- ],


2. Make sure your theme is based off of collective.responsivetheme. In your plonetheme.yourcustomtheme/plonetheme/yourcustomtheme/profiles/default/ find your skins.xml file change the <skin-path> **based-on=""** to Responsive Theme. ::

<skin-path name="Your Custom Theme" based-on="Responsive Theme">
...
</skin-path>


3. Make sure when you install your theme, it also installs collective.responsivetheme. In your plonetheme.yourcustomtheme/plonetheme/yourcustomtheme/profiles/default/ find your metadata.xml file. We need to add the dependancy. Like so: ::

<?xml version="1.0"?>
<metadata>
<version>1000</version>
<dependencies>
<dependency>profile-collective.responsivetheme:default</dependency>
</dependencies>
</metadata>


Changelog
=========
1.3 (2012-11-15)
----------------
- Added Scott Jehl's Respond.js which enables responsive web designs in browsers that don't support CSS3 Media Queries - in particular, Internet Explorer 8 and under. It's written in such a way that it will probably patch support for other non-supporting browsers as well.

1.2.2 (2012-09-04)
-----------------
- underline in this history.txt file wasn't long enough. Had to make new version.

1.2.1 (2012-09-04)
-----------------
- Fixed an issue where logo.pt was asking for the title

1.2 (2012-08-30)
----------------
- Fixed the issue of the navigation folding for IE 8 and below

1.0 (2012-07-02)
----------------

- Initial release

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

collective.responsivetheme-1.3.zip (40.2 kB view details)

Uploaded Source

collective.responsivetheme-1.3.tar.gz (26.7 kB view details)

Uploaded Source

File details

Details for the file collective.responsivetheme-1.3.zip.

File metadata

File hashes

Hashes for collective.responsivetheme-1.3.zip
Algorithm Hash digest
SHA256 701a81f82c0fbde560a4b5b3f52ca4fc79c997430d29d8a850c5827fbf230851
MD5 f0a9c4140c94192d0dfce16b4a666d7a
BLAKE2b-256 aa18f95eaaf63be6ed5d740da79d929d83e27d31edf9534b00ef4c38c39a1750

See more details on using hashes here.

Provenance

File details

Details for the file collective.responsivetheme-1.3.tar.gz.

File metadata

File hashes

Hashes for collective.responsivetheme-1.3.tar.gz
Algorithm Hash digest
SHA256 0dbcad1a8b4ae1609c4800764c01a3be84576bb66d211bcb35ae913091fe3137
MD5 0466417348c03b0bba09101c2925fc94
BLAKE2b-256 3064e77c4dbb3414c1f66c7e6fa7d3645a4f72b26aedc565a05d3531511a342c

See more details on using hashes here.

Provenance

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page